The Fronius Smart Meter records the current power at the feed-in point and transfers the
data to the inverter. By controlling the Ohmpilot, the inverter adjusts any surplus energy
that is available to zero. In detail, this takes place by continuously adjusting the heating
element connected to the Ohmpilot. Surplus energy is consumed using the heating ele-
ment in a continuously variable manner.
The temperature is measured by the Ohmpilot. If the temperature falls below the mini-
mum, then an external source (e.g. gas-fired heating) will be activated until the minimum
temperature is reached again, so that the Ohmpilot only uses surplus energy and does
not draw any energy from the grid.
The maximum temperature must be set on the heating element thermostat. If the heating
element does not have a thermostat, the Ohmpilot can also carry out this task as an al-
